Haven't checked the fluid level recently, but I will. No signs of leakage.

The gear guys actually recommended a locker but I wanted something with better street manners. They said the G80 was designed to keep the rear end of the truck from getting ahead of the front on wet/slippery surfaces. That's why it won't lock up once you are already rolling. After being used to the G80, I had a couple scares after the TT first went in. Now I switch to Auto 4WD whenever the roads are wet, just in case I forget about the TT in back.
